Q3 planning: the Harwick Lane office closes end of quarter. Headcount of twelve transfers to Veldane Systems' main hub; three roles eliminated. Severance accrual booked this period. Lease buyout negotiated at reduced penalty; final figure pending landlord sign-off. Expect one-time charges in Q3, savings flowing from Q4. Finance to reconcile fixed assets and terminate local vendor contracts by month-end. Do not circulate beyond this team. The confidential note below outlines the plans driving this decision.

board note of baguf-fafog: Kasixox Foods plans to lower the Drueth list price by 48 percent in March.

# Firmwell Update Channel — Environments

Three channels: dev, beta, stable. Plugins targeting the Firmwell device-firmware pipeline must declare a channel; unsigned builds only ship on dev. Beta promotes nightly, stable promotes weekly after soak. Rollback is automatic on checksum mismatch. Do not hardcode channel endpoints — read them from the environment manifest. The beta environment currently runs with the following configuration.

config for kagup-hahig:
druwyn:
  pin: 2801
  metrics_host: metrics.druwyn.zemvarlabs.internal
  tenant: sorius
  seal: seal_798a43d7

// Heads up, plugin authors: the Ledgerbird sandbox payments API is notoriously
// flaky in integration tests. The settlement webhook sometimes fires twice,
// so always make your handlers idempotent or CI will haunt you.
// This client points at the Quillport staging gateway, which is more stable
// than prod-mirror. Retries are capped at three with jittered backoff.
// Use the sandbox credential that follows for your local runs.

app token of bahaf-tajeg = zpat23_SjjsllwiLmXbtS65veZaV47

The Thornbury branch cash-box run moves to Wednesdays starting next week, per Finance. Pickup remains the rear loading bay at Pellford House; the dispatch desk should book Merrow Secure Transit for the 10:30 slot and confirm the night before. The box travels sealed with both tags intact — if either tag is broken at collection, the run is cancelled and Finance notified immediately. No stand-in couriers without prior approval. At collection, the courier must carry out the hand-over instruction set out below.

handover note for yagef-bagep: the drudor pelius courier leaves the kasdor zorvan norir ledger at gate 8016 under passcode 755406